| Role | Typical Salary Range | Why It Pays |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| AI Architect | $180k – $400k+ | High technical complexity; requires designing the "brains" of enterprise AI systems. | Engineers who love deep tech and neural network design. |
| Engineering Manager | $150k – $340k | Combines high-level coding knowledge with the soft skills needed to lead global teams. | Natural leaders with a strong technical background. |
| Enterprise Account Executive | $180k – $360k+ (OTE) | Directly impacts company revenue; requires high-stakes negotiation skills. | Persuasive communicators who thrive on targets. |
| Product Manager (Senior/Director) | $140k – $320k | Bridge between business and tech; requires vision and complex decision-making. | Strategic thinkers who enjoy high-level problem-solving. |
| Cybersecurity Director | $160k – $280k | Massive risk mitigation is essential for protecting global data and company reputation. | Detail-oriented experts who handle high-pressure stakes. |
| Data Scientist (Staff/Lead) | $130k – $270k | Essential for turning massive datasets into actionable business profit. | Math whizzes who can translate data into stories. |
| Sustainability (ESG) Director | $120k – $250k | High demand due to new global regulations and corporate branding needs. | Values-driven leaders with policy or environmental expertise. |

5. Do remote jobs pay less?
Not necessarily, but the answer often depends on geographic pay policies. Companies generally follow one of two models:
- Location-Based Pay: Most large firms (like Google or Meta) adjust your salary based on the cost of living in your "home base." A remote worker in San Francisco will likely earn more than a remote worker in a rural area for the exact same role.
- Location-Agnostic Pay: A growing number of "Remote-First" startups pay a flat, high rate regardless of where you live. In these cases, moving to a low-cost area effectively gives you a massive "purchasing power" raise.
The "Remote Discount" vs. "The Talent Premium"
While some data suggests remote roles can pay 5–10% less due to lower overhead or high competition, specialised roles (AI, Lead Engineering, Senior Sales) are immune to this. For high-demand talent, companies prioritize skill over location and pay top-tier market rates to secure the best candidate.
